Surgery booked
Hi
I am brand new and very nervous about pending surgery.
I have opted to have a hysterectomy because for many reasons the Mirena IUD I have inserted is not working out. I have fibroids and an enlarged uterus. I am 46 years old.
I am not worried about not having a uterus, this does not bother me at all, however I am very nervous about having surgery.
Any words of encouragement would be appreciated.

Re: Surgery booked
My doctor had told me that I would be crazy if I weren't nervous about my surgery but it is how you deal with the nervousness that makes a difference. I did not let the nerves take over and kept reminding myself that everyone in the operating room wants things to go right and it is in their best interest to make sure they have have a successful outcome. I found the strength to be completely calm and relaxed prior to surgery and I think it made a huge difference. Just keep reminding yourself that everyone in the OR wants you to be better than ok and if on the off chance that something doesn't go as planned that they are trained to deal with it. It is ok to be nervous, it is not ok to let your fear take over. Stay in control and stay strong. You will do fine and before you know it you will be better than ever. Sending positive energy your way.

Re: Surgery booked
I agree with Cheryl. You have to put your trust in the surgeon and team, and realise that in this situation you have no control. I understand the fear. You do have to be brave. I have read that some of the hyster ladies have had an anti anxiety or pre med prior to surgery to calm them, if you need it. I had my hubby with me to distract me until it was my turn. But the walk into the operating theatre was still a little scary. Be brave, trust, sleep. It will be ok.
